歡迎您光臨本站 註冊首頁

heartbeat產生大量nodename日誌,這正常嗎?

←手機掃碼閱讀     火星人 @ 2014-03-04 , reply:0

heartbeat產生大量nodename日誌,這正常嗎?

用虛擬機測試,兩台伺服器heartbeat服務都起來后,情況如下:
看了下日誌,發現大量的 nodename linuxtwo.com uuid changed to linuxone.com,這個正常嗎?
伺服器一:
# ifconfig
eth0      Link encap:Ethernet  HWaddr 00:0C:29:D4:5C:EC
          inet addr:192.168.0.192  Bcast:192.168.0.255  Mask:255.255.255.0
          inet6 addr: fe80::20c:29ff:fed4:5cec/64 Scope:Link
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:2902 errors:0 dropped:0 overruns:0 frame:0
          TX packets:2360 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:325739 (318.1 KiB)  TX bytes:531793 (519.3 KiB)
          Interrupt:185 Base address:0x2000

eth0:0    Link encap:Ethernet  HWaddr 00:0C:29:D4:5C:EC
          inet addr:192.168.0.194  Bcast:192.168.0.255  Mask:255.255.255.0
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          Interrupt:185 Base address:0x2000

eth1      Link encap:Ethernet  HWaddr 00:0C:29:D4:5C:F6
          inet addr:1.1.1.1  Bcast:1.1.1.255  Mask:255.255.255.0
          inet6 addr: fe80::20c:29ff:fed4:5cf6/64 Scope:Link
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:1179 errors:0 dropped:0 overruns:0 frame:0
          TX packets:500 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:214414 (209.3 KiB)  TX bytes:84002 (82.0 KiB)
          Interrupt:177 Base address:0x2080

lo        Link encap:Local Loopback
          inet addr:127.0.0.1  Mask:255.0.0.0
          inet6 addr: ::1/128 Scope:Host
          UP LOOPBACK RUNNING  MTU:16436  Metric:1
          RX packets:55 errors:0 dropped:0 overruns:0 frame:0
          TX packets:55 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:4746 (4.6 KiB)  TX bytes:4746 (4.6 KiB)

伺服器二:# ifconfig
eth0      Link encap:Ethernet  HWaddr 00:0C:29:0F:02:B9
          inet addr:192.168.0.193  Bcast:192.168.0.255  Mask:255.255.255.0
          inet6 addr: fe80::20c:29ff:fe0f:2b9/64 Scope:Link
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:1552 errors:0 dropped:0 overruns:0 frame:0
          TX packets:89 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:233684 (228.2 KiB)  TX bytes:9706 (9.4 KiB)
          Interrupt:185 Base address:0x2000

eth0:0    Link encap:Ethernet  HWaddr 00:0C:29:0F:02:B9
          inet addr:192.168.0.194  Bcast:192.168.0.255  Mask:255.255.255.0
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          Interrupt:185 Base address:0x2000

eth1      Link encap:Ethernet  HWaddr 00:0C:29:0F:02:C3
          inet addr:1.1.1.2  Bcast:1.1.1.255  Mask:255.255.255.0
          inet6 addr: fe80::20c:29ff:fe0f:2c3/64 Scope:Link
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:1189 errors:0 dropped:0 overruns:0 frame:0
          TX packets:362 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:157319 (153.6 KiB)  TX bytes:76340 (74.5 KiB)
          Interrupt:177 Base address:0x2080

lo        Link encap:Local Loopback
          inet addr:127.0.0.1  Mask:255.0.0.0
          inet6 addr: ::1/128 Scope:Host
          UP LOOPBACK RUNNING  MTU:16436  Metric:1
          RX packets:10 errors:0 dropped:0 overruns:0 frame:0
          TX packets:10 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:728 (728.0 b)  TX bytes:728 (728.0 b)




日誌:
heartbeat: 2006/07/14_10:08:04 WARN: nodename linuxtwo.com uuid changed to linuxone.com
heartbeat: 2006/07/14_10:08:04 WARN: nodename linuxone.com uuid changed to linuxtwo.com
heartbeat: 2006/07/14_10:08:04 ERROR: should_drop_message: attempted replay attack ?
heartbeat: 2006/07/14_10:08:04 WARN: nodename linuxtwo.com uuid changed to linuxone.com
heartbeat: 2006/07/14_10:08:05 WARN: nodename linuxone.com uuid changed to linuxtwo.com
heartbeat: 2006/07/14_10:08:05 ERROR: should_drop_message: attempted replay attack ?
heartbeat: 2006/07/14_10:08:06 WARN: nodename linuxtwo.com uuid changed to linuxone.com
heartbeat: 2006/07/14_10:08:07 WARN: nodename linuxone.com uuid changed to linuxtwo.com
《解決方案》

/etc/ha.d/resoource.d/LVSSyncDaemonSwap master status
應該是一台機器為stop 一台為running
你的兩台機器 eth0:0都為92.168.0.194 ?
《解決方案》

問題出在這裡啊,我兩台伺服器都有eth0:0
我也絕的不對,但是可以使用。
我用http://192.168.0.194刷網頁,可以看到
this is 192.168.0.192
然後我關閉192.168.0.192
等兩分鐘,我再用http://192.168.0.194刷網頁,可以看到
this is 192.168.0.193
《解決方案》

# ifconfig
eth0      Link encap:Ethernet  HWaddr 00:0C:29:D4:5C:EC
          inet addr:192.168.0.192  Bcast:192.168.0.255  Mask:255.255.255.0
          inet6 addr: fe80::20c:29ff:fed4:5cec/64 Scope:Link
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:10453 errors:0 dropped:0 overruns:0 frame:0
          TX packets:7111 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:1397744 (1.3 MiB)  TX bytes:1014259 (990.4 KiB)
          Interrupt:185 Base address:0x2000

eth0:0    Link encap:Ethernet  HWaddr 00:0C:29:D4:5C:EC
          inet addr:192.168.0.194  Bcast:192.168.0.255  Mask:255.255.255.0
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          Interrupt:185 Base address:0x2000

eth1      Link encap:Ethernet  HWaddr 00:0C:29:D4:5C:F6
          inet addr:1.1.1.1  Bcast:1.1.1.255  Mask:255.255.255.0
          inet6 addr: fe80::20c:29ff:fed4:5cf6/64 Scope:Link
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:4821 errors:0 dropped:0 overruns:0 frame:0
          TX packets:1897 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:818788 (799.5 KiB)  TX bytes:386853 (377.7 KiB)
          Interrupt:177 Base address:0x2080

lo        Link encap:Local Loopback
          inet addr:127.0.0.1  Mask:255.0.0.0
          inet6 addr: ::1/128 Scope:Host
          UP LOOPBACK RUNNING  MTU:16436  Metric:1
          RX packets:55 errors:0 dropped:0 overruns:0 frame:0
          TX packets:55 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:4746 (4.6 KiB)  TX bytes:4746 (4.6 KiB)

# /etc/ha.d/resource.d/LVSSyncDaemonSwap master status
master stopped



# ifconfig
eth0      Link encap:Ethernet  HWaddr 00:0C:29:0F:02:B9
          inet addr:192.168.0.193  Bcast:192.168.0.255  Mask:255.255.255.0
          inet6 addr: fe80::20c:29ff:fe0f:2b9/64 Scope:Link
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:7288 errors:0 dropped:0 overruns:0 frame:0
          TX packets:1990 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:1092195 (1.0 MiB)  TX bytes:253846 (247.8 KiB)
          Interrupt:185 Base address:0x2000

eth0:0    Link encap:Ethernet  HWaddr 00:0C:29:0F:02:B9
          inet addr:192.168.0.194  Bcast:192.168.0.255  Mask:255.255.255.0
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          Interrupt:185 Base address:0x2000

eth1      Link encap:Ethernet  HWaddr 00:0C:29:0F:02:C3
          inet addr:1.1.1.2  Bcast:1.1.1.255  Mask:255.255.255.0
          inet6 addr: fe80::20c:29ff:fe0f:2c3/64 Scope:Link
          UP BROADCAST RUNNING MULTICAST  MTU:1500  Metric:1
          RX packets:4144 errors:0 dropped:0 overruns:0 frame:0
          TX packets:1633 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:1000
          RX bytes:619078 (604.5 KiB)  TX bytes:351888 (343.6 KiB)
          Interrupt:177 Base address:0x2080

lo        Link encap:Local Loopback
          inet addr:127.0.0.1  Mask:255.0.0.0
          inet6 addr: ::1/128 Scope:Host
          UP LOOPBACK RUNNING  MTU:16436  Metric:1
          RX packets:10 errors:0 dropped:0 overruns:0 frame:0
          TX packets:10 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:728 (728.0 b)  TX bytes:728 (728.0 b)

# /etc/ha.d/resource.d/LVSSyncDaemonSwap master status
master stopped

網頁訪問正常。
《解決方案》

配置錯誤吧應該是
主要是參考http://www.ultramonkey.org/3/topologies/sl-ha-lb-eg.html
安裝環境centos4.4

1>下在安裝必要的軟體包
  rpm -ivh http://dev.centos.org/centos/4/testing/i386/RPMS/heartbeat-pils-2.0.8-2.el4.centos.i386.rpm
yum install net-snmp-libs
rpm -ivh http://dev.centos.org/centos/4/testing/i386/RPMS/heartbeat-stonith-2.0.8-2.el4.centos.i386.rpm
yum install gnutls
rpm -ivh http://dev.centos.org/centos/4/testing/i386/RPMS/heartbeat-gui-2.0.8-2.el4.centos.i386.rpm
yum install perl-Crypt-SSLeay
yum install perl-HTML-Parser
yum install perl-LDAP
yum install perl-Net-DNS
yum install perl-libwww-perl
yum install perl-Net-IMAP-Simple-SSL
yum install perl-Net-IMAP-Simple
yum install perl-MailTools
rpm -ivh http://ftp.riken.go.jp/pub/Linux/dag/packages/perl-Data-HexDump/perl-Data-HexDump-0.02-1.2.el4.rf.noarch.rpm
rpm -ivh http://ftp.riken.go.jp/pub/Linux/dag/packages/perl-Authen-Radius/perl-Authen-Radius-0.13-1.rh9.rf.noarch.rpm
rpm -ivh http://dev.centos.org/centos/4/testing/i386/RPMS/heartbeat-2.0.8-2.el4.centos.i386.rpm
rpm -ivh http://mirror.centos.org/centos/4.4/csgfs/i386/RPMS/ipvsadm-1.24-6.i386.rpm
rpm -ivh http://dev.centos.org/centos/4/testing/i386/RPMS/heartbeat-ldirectord-2.0.8-2.el4.centos.i386.rpm
yum install arptables_jf
yum install libnet

2>配置幾個主要文件
################## /etc/ha.d/ldirectord #######################
nod1  ldirectord::ldirectord.cf       LVSSyncDaemonSwap::master       IPaddr2::192.168.1.2/24/eth0/192.168.1.255
###############################################################

################## /etc/ha.d/ldirectord.cf ####################
checktimeout=3
checkinterval=1
#fallback=127.0.0.1:80
autoreload=yes
logfile="/var/log/ldirectord.log"
#logfile="local0"
emailalert="**@**.com"
emailalertfreq=7200
#emailalertstatus=all
quiescent=yes

# Sample for an http virtual service
virtual=192.168.1.2:80
        real=192.168.1.3:80 gate
        real=192.168.1.4:80 gate
        fallback=127.0.0.1:80
        service=http
        request="hbtest.html"
        receive="hello"
        #virtualhost=www.***.com
        scheduler=rr
        #persistent=600
        #netmask=255.255.255.255
        protocol=tcp
        checktype=negotiate
        checkport=80
###############################################################

################### /ect/ha.d/ha.cf ###########################
keepalive 2
deadtime 30
warntime 10
initdead 120
udpport 694
ucast Internal_IP_Address
auto_failback on
node    nod1
node    nod2
###############################################################

##############/etc/sysconfig/network-scripts/ifcfg-lo:0#############
DEVICE=lo:0
IPADDR=192.168.1.2
NETMASK=255.255.255.255
NETWORK=192.168.1.255
BROADCAST=192.168.1.255
ONBOOT=yes
NAME=loopback
#################################################################

3>啟動
/etc/init.d/heartbeat stop
service ldirectord stop
/etc/ha.d/resource.d/LVSSyncDaemonSwap master stop
/etc/init.d/arptables_jf stop
/usr/sbin/arptables-noarp-addr 192.168.1.2 start
/etc/init.d/arptables_jf save
/etc/init.d/arptables_jf start
/etc/init.d/heartbeat/start
ifup lo

4>注意事項
*ip addr sh  檢查IP分配是否正確

*ipvsadm  -L -n   檢查服務情況

*/etc/ha.d/resource.d/LVSSyncyncDaemonSwap master status   檢查均衡情況,正確應該是master上為on, Slave上為off

*特別注意認真閱讀文檔!!!
  Note that a netmask of 255.255.255.255 on the lo:0 interface indicates that this interface will only accept traffic 192.168.6.240.
《解決方案》

/etc/ha.d/ldirectord 在參考中一個只也沒有提過,不知道ls講是的什麼
我的heartbeat 用命令yum安裝的,
只有一條安裝命令yum install heartbeat*
沒有發現/etc/ha.d/ldirectord這個文件,我聲明下,我模擬的只是ha,不包括lvs的。
我的參考資料是:
http://www.clusting.com/cluster/HA/heartbeat_1.html

[火星人 ] heartbeat產生大量nodename日誌,這正常嗎?已經有934次圍觀

http://coctec.com/docs/service/show-post-8136.html